Soundcore 3/Soundcore Select 2 vs LG Xboom Grab

Last updated: September 16, 2026

Short answer: the Soundcore 3/Soundcore Select 2. It ranks #57 of 142 medium speakers by sound quality at $49.99; the LG Xboom Grab ranks #85 and costs $97.73, which makes this an easy call rather than a real tradeoff.

Soundcore 3/Soundcore Select 2 vs LG Xboom Grab

What the Soundcore 3/Soundcore Select 2 offers: Soundcore 3/Soundcore Select 2 uses 2x 38mm (1.5”) titanium diaphragm full-range drivers + 2x passive radiators. Its 372 g, claimed 24 hours (Manufacturer specified) battery life, IPX7 protection, up to 99dB and stereo playback make it a practical option for its intended room or portable use. Watch for: Bass is limited by its 60Hz specification.

What the LG Xboom Grab offers: 20 hour battery life - longer than the JBL Flip 7 or UE Boom 4. IP67 rated with elastic mounting straps. App unlocks AI room calibration, EQ, and light-strip customization; multipoint pairing. Watch for: Bass extension not as deep as the top speakers. Overpriced. This may move around in the rankings as we get better sound samples

Buy the Soundcore 3/Soundcore Select 2. It ranks higher for sound quality than the LG Xboom Grab and costs less, so there is no real case for the other one.

Specifications Side By Side

Soundcore 3/Soundcore Select 2 LG Xboom Grab
Price$49.99$97.73
Ranked#57 of 142 in Medium Size Portable Bluetooth Speakers#85 of 142 in Medium Size Portable Bluetooth Speakers
AppYesYes
Bass Extension (-10dB)60Hz75Hz
Battery Life24 hours (Manufacturer specified)20 hours (Manufacturer specified)
EQYesYes
Bluetooth Latency180ms-
Maximum SPL99dB (measured by Alan Ross Reviews)-
Party ModeYes (PartyCast up to 100 speakers)Yes (Auracast)
StereoYesNo
OmnidirectionalNoPointing up
Weight0.8 lbs (372 g)1.5 lbs (680 g)
Bluetooth Version5.05.3
Dimensions6.9" x 2.2" x 2.3" (174 x 57 x 59 mm)-
Amplifier Power16W30W
Drivers2x 38mm (1.5") titanium diaphragm full-range drivers + 2x passive radiators1x 80x45mm racetrack woofer, 1x 16mm tweeter
IP RatingIPX7IP67
Digital Aux InputNoNo
Bluetooth CodecsSBC (inferred; additional codecs unverified)AAC, SBC
Power Input-USB-C
TWS-No
Wi-Fi-No
